Since her entry into the industry, Lakmini has maintained a consistent presence on the big screen, often taking on central protagonist roles. Her credits include:

Sarungal (2018): Lakmini portrayed the character Asanki, marking one of her early significant leading roles.

Husma (2019): In this drama-thriller, she played Tharuka Wijesinghe, a performance that garnered significant attention for its emotional weight.

Ethalaya (2020): An action-oriented project where she continued to build her reputation as a leading lady.

Piyambanna Ayeth (2022): She starred as Sadisha, further cementing her status in the romantic drama genre.

Within the Sound of Silence (2023): A short film where she appeared as Melanie.

Varna (2024): One of her most recent major releases, where she took on the role of Anuradha. Beef (2024): A short film featuring Lakmini as Piyumi.

In addition to film, she has appeared in television productions such as the series Sunday 3 to 6 (2017) and the mini-series Outsider (2023). Notable Movie Moments

Chamathka Lakmini is a rising star in the Sinhala cinema industry, recognized for her ability to tackle complex, dramatic roles that push the boundaries of traditional Sri Lankan film. Her filmography, though relatively recent, includes several bold and notable performances. Filmography & Key Roles

Lakmini has appeared in several feature films and television series, often portraying characters caught in intense emotional or psychological situations.

Husma (2019): Portraying the character Tharuka Wijesinghe, this drama-thriller is perhaps her most widely discussed role. It is a remake of the Spanish film The Corpse of Anna Fritz.

Varna (2024): She plays the character Anuradha in this 2024 release.

Piyambanna Ayeth (2022): She starred as Sadisha in this film.

Ethalaya (2020): A film where she is credited for a notable role early in her career.

Sarungal (2018): She played Asanki, marking one of her earlier entries into the film industry.

Teledramas & Shorts: Her versatility extends to television in series like Sunday 3 to 6 (playing Teena) and short films like Within the Sound of Silence (2023), where she played Melanie. Notable Movie Moments

Critics and fans often highlight Lakmini’s work in Husma as a defining moment in her career. The role required a high level of physical and emotional control, as the film's premise involves a woman mistakenly presumed dead, leading to a harrowing sequence of events.
